diff options
author | gumi <git@gumi.ca> | 2020-08-10 14:46:07 -0400 |
---|---|---|
committer | gumi <git@gumi.ca> | 2020-08-10 14:46:07 -0400 |
commit | 0fe3a6fde2769b55b0019487d9939bf628c760b2 (patch) | |
tree | 85d9cde3b6f22e6a3f49ce55b694e41ee8fcf54d | |
parent | f032ae046477ae96ea518ad3e12e5508bc4edba7 (diff) | |
download | serverdata-0fe3a6fde2769b55b0019487d9939bf628c760b2.tar.gz serverdata-0fe3a6fde2769b55b0019487d9939bf628c760b2.tar.bz2 serverdata-0fe3a6fde2769b55b0019487d9939bf628c760b2.tar.xz serverdata-0fe3a6fde2769b55b0019487d9939bf628c760b2.zip |
add debug commands to call the crafting menus
-rw-r--r-- | npc/functions/crafting.txt | 23 |
1 files changed, 23 insertions, 0 deletions
diff --git a/npc/functions/crafting.txt b/npc/functions/crafting.txt index ba032f41..05a9d9a6 100644 --- a/npc/functions/crafting.txt +++ b/npc/functions/crafting.txt @@ -91,4 +91,27 @@ function script SmithSystem { return .success; } +- script @craft FAKE_NPC,{ + public function DoTailoring { + SmithSystem(CRAFT_TAILORING); + end; + } + + public function DoSmithery { + SmithSystem(CRAFT_SMITHERY); + end; + } + public function OnInit { + if (debug < 1) { + end; + } + + bindatcmd("@tailoring", sprintf("%s::%s", .name$, "DoTailoring")); + bindatcmd("@tailor", sprintf("%s::%s", .name$, "DoTailoring")); + bindatcmd("@smithery", sprintf("%s::%s", .name$, "DoSmithery")); + bindatcmd("@smith", sprintf("%s::%s", .name$, "DoSmithery")); + bindatcmd("@blacksmithery", sprintf("%s::%s", .name$, "DoSmithery")); + end; + } +} |